Output 834d5161c17c1034d7d3f16ad434e7bcaa18e027bb9e16d3a409c0c8bce5cb74:62

value
121592
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ec4f4b1d320ff95354d8284fc7254f7f333dce1b OP_EQUAL
address
3PEWPDe6YsAGFJYifgYCw6xwo6DEBMxXAj
transaction
834d5161c17c1034d7d3f16ad434e7bcaa18e027bb9e16d3a409c0c8bce5cb74
spent
true